Explanation
This ordinance authorizes the City Clerk to enter into a grant agreement with Artway to operate as a fiscal agent in support of the Sounds from the Living Room event in the Southside neighborhood.
Artway Inc. is a non-profit organization in Columbus that will provide support to the Atelier 411 Studios’ “Sounds from the Living Room” event. The production studio empowers and uplifts underrepresented filmmakers in the Columbus community. Their mission is to build a film studio that serves as a vehicle to provide distribution, jobs, and opportunities to these underserved filmmakers. The Sounds from the Living Room is Atelier 411’s flagship event, combining the power of storytelling with the sensory journey of house music to create a community space where everyone can connect, feel at home, and celebrate the art of filmmaking.
This event will bring together members of the southside community in Columbus to create a safe and inclusive space for attendees to enjoy live music and connect with neighbors. The program will also promote local businesses by exposing them to the community.
Emergency legislation is required to allow for deposits to be made in advance of the event to secure equipment for the live music and for deposits on contracts with local artists and performers.
Fiscal Impact: Funding is available within the Job Growth subfund.
Title
To authorize the City Clerk to enter into a grant agreement with Artway Inc to serve as a fiscal agent in support of the Sounds from the Living Room event; and to authorize an appropriation and expenditure within the Job Growth subfund; and to declare an emergency. ($11,000.00)
